Is there a minimum rental duration for charter boats?

Asked 6 months ago
Yes, there is a minimum rental duration for charter boats with Barecat BVI Charters. The minimum rental duration varies depending on the specific boat and the time of year. During peak season, which typically runs from December to April, the minimum rental duration is typically 7 days. However, during the low season, which usually extends from May to November, the minimum duration may be shorter, ranging from 3 to 5 days. These minimum rental durations are in place to ensure that guests have enough time to fully enjoy and explore the beautiful British Virgin Islands. Please note that specific details regarding minimum rental durations can be found on the website or by contacting Barecat BVI Charters directly.
